Abstract
The character of C60 fullerene dispersion and its temperature dependence in various polymer matrices has been studied by UV-Vis spectroscopy and thermodesorption mass spectrometry. It is established that the degree of fullerene aggregation in these composites varies from molecular-dispersed state to largesize clusters. For the polymers studied, the initial dispersed state is most stable with respect to temperature in the case of poly-α-methylstyrene.
